About LOCBID Construction Inc
LOCBID Construction, Inc. offers a wide array of services through commercial construction, offices, condominiums, hospitals and banks. Although residential work had been the company's focus for many years these days LOCBID is mostly about commercial construction. However, custom-built homes, remodeling and commercial additions can be added to the long list of projects that LOCBID has constructed.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Lewiston?

Understanding the cost of living near Lewiston is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at LOCBID Construction Inc.
Lewiston's Cost of Living Index is approximately 92.5 (7.5% less expensive than US average; 8.9% less than ME average). Paired with Auburn ('L-A'), historic mill city, more affordable housing. Citylink/ATS. When planning your budget based on a salary from LOCBID Construction Inc,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,000 - $1,500+ A significant portion of LOCBID Construction Inc sal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$160 - $270 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$30 (Citylink/ATS mon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$410 - $600 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$330 - $630+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$370 - $690+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,300 - $3,690+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
